Thinstuff XP/VS Terminal Server is a popular software solution designed to turn a standard Windows system into a full-featured Terminal Server (Remote Desktop Session Host). By allowing multiple users to access a single Windows machine simultaneously, it provides a cost-effective alternative to expensive Windows Server Remote Desktop Services (RDS) Client Access Licenses (CALs).
